How Our Bathroom Water Damage Restoration Process Works
When you call us for bathroom water damage restoration, you can expect a thorough and efficient process that gets your bathroom back to normal in no time. Our team will assess the damage, extract the water, dry the area, and restore your bathroom to its original condition.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We’ll send a team of experts to your property to assess the damage and create a customized plan to restore your bathroom. This includes identifying the source of the water damage and fixing it before we start the restoration process. Our team uses infrared cameras to detect hidden moisture and ensure that all affected areas are addressed.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use industrial-grade pumps and vacuum equipment to extract as much water as possible from your bathroom. Our team will also remove any wet insulation, drywall, or flooring to prevent further dam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use industrial dehumidifiers and air movers to dry your bathroom quickly and efficiently. Our team will also monitor the humidity levels to ensure that your bathroom is completely dry before we start the restoration process.
Step 4: Restoration and Repair
Once your bathroom is dry, our team will start the restoration process. This includes repairing or replacing any damaged materials, such as drywall, flooring, or cabinets. We’ll also replace any wet or damaged insulation to ensure that your bathroom is warm and cozy.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leanup
Before we consider the job complete, our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that your bathroom is completely dry and free of any remaining moisture. We’ll also clean up any debris and leave your bathroom looking like new.

Bathroom Water Damage Restoration Cost in Midvale Park, AZ
The cost of bathroom water damage restoration can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Midvale Park, AZ.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ed |
| Drying and d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ed |
| Restoration and repair |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ials needed |
